§ 18855

Added by Stats. 1970, Ch. 1385.

It is unlawful for any person to neglect or refuse to attend and testify or to answer any lawful inquiry, or to produce documentary evidence, if such evidence is available to him, in obedience to the subpoena or lawful requirement of the director.
